Power Supply Distribution System
Total Load of Laboratory building shall be fed from existing substation at 415V. 2 Nos. 415V, 630A
feeders from Owner’s existing 415V switchboard shall be utilized for feeding complete load of LAB
such as Lab instruments, PCs, Printers, Air-Conditioning, Lighting & miscellaneous loads through
2 Nos. 415V Main distribution boards (MDBs) with single incomer scheme one in each floor of the
laboratory building. Details of existing substation will be provided to successful bidder. Out of 2 no.
MDBs, 1 no. is existing (MDB-0131) and the same shall be utilized for ground floor power
distribution. Further distribution to all loads of the laboratory shall be as per key Single Line
Diagram A416-000-16-50-1001, A416-000-16-50-1002.
Distribution of power to 240V AC 1-phase sockets (for instruments, PCs, printers and air-
conditioning units) shall be through Power Panels (PP), having TPN MCB+ELCB incoming and
DP MCB outgoing circuits, as required. Power panels shall be wall-mounted type and shall be fed
from 415V PDBs. Separate power panels shall be provided for instruments/ PCs/ printers and for
A/C sockets. Lighting loads of the lab building shall be fed through Lighting Panels (LP), similar to
power panels
415V AC 3-phase sockets shall be fed from 415V switchboard through wall-mounted distribution
boards (MDB), having 3-phase MCCB incoming and 3-phase MCB+ELCB outgoing circuits, as
required.
Supply, Laying & Termination of main incoming power cables to the MDBs from Owner’s
substation will be done by Owner/other Contractor.
2. AREA CLASSIFICATION
Although the Laboratory Building is located in safe area and is not classified, the following rooms shall be provided with flameproof lighting fixtures and switch sockets as mentioned below:
i. Rooms to be provided with flameproof Ex(d), gas group IIA, IIB lighting fixtures and flameproof Ex(d) gas group IIA, IIB switch sockets:
i) Polymer QC Lab-1 & 2 (Ground Floor) ii) Polymer Process Lab-1 & 2 (Ground Floor) iii) Petrochemical Lab (First Floor)
ii. Rooms to be provided with Flameproof Ex(d), gas group IIC lighting fixtures and Flameproof
Ex(d) gas group IIC switch sockets:
i) Spectroscopic Lab (First Floor) ii) Gas Chromatographic Lab (First Floor)
iii. Rooms to be provided with flameproof Ex(d), gas group IIA, IIB lighting fixtures only:

i) Chemical Reagent Room (Ground Floor) ii) Glass ware store (Ground Floor)
All other rooms/areas including corridors have been provided with safe area lighting fixtures and
switch sockets. All electrical equipment for hazardous areas shall be tested by CMRI/ CIMFR
(Central Institute of Mines and Fuel Research) or equivalent authorized testing agency of the
country of origin and approved by PESo/ CCoE. Surface temperature for all hazardous area
equipment shall be limited to 200°C (T3 class).
